My 2002 Ford Explorer Eddie Bauer Edition has 133K miles on it, and is blowing white smoke out the exhaust pipe for about 30-60 seconds after the initial start-up in the morning. The smoke also has a smell to it. I've also noticed that I've needed to top off the coolant occassionaly lately also. Is this possibly a head gasket issue?.....but there is not a milky film on the oil dip stick. How else would coolant be leaking into the exhaust since it's not leaking on the garage floor? Could be just condensation if not and there's no external leaks-nothing in the crankcase get it block and pressure tested to rule out a blown headgasket, cracked head or block.
